Academic Degrees
Ed. D. Mississippi State University – 1987 – Counselor Education
M.Div. Southwestern Baptist Theological Seminary – 1977
B.S.E. Delta State College – 1973 – Physical Education, Math
A.A. East Central Junior College – 1970 – Physical Education

Professional Experience
1988-present Campbell University,  Associate Professor of Counselor Education; since 
1995 have also served as Adjunct Professor, Campbell University Divinity School
1978-1988, 10  years experience as Pastor of two Baptist churches,  Scooba Baptist Church,
Scooba, MS, and Fayette Baptist Church, Fayette, MS
1982-1988, concurrently served as campus Minister, East Mississippi Community College,
Scooba, Ms
1986-1987, Chaplain Intern, East Mississippi State Hospital, Meridian, MS
Two and one half years teaching experience in public schools of Mississippi
